Transaction ed21af5a51b617caad36de40b49529eda05f17dae71c31845ab804bc2fde86ea
1 Input
1 Output
-
ed21af5a51b617caad36de40b49529eda05f17dae71c31845ab804bc2fde86ea:0
- value
- 2315634
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 a1ba81f6cf16ceb23c425b0b437a4bdae19ba6a8 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1Fk9DfZtShC9hcTKiUfvEAiiGiNjhycFgP